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
856690731 1065363899 20 052 0158930
503 43302 79495
503 43302 79495
336022339 97 86 760 55971
All about undefined
Interested in learning more?
503 43302 79495
336022339 97 86 760 55971
See more
60681048829 50 549779
99323547486 29562263 78175069 85742577
See more
124829 780 1889695
14065 0141069 06467
See more